S-VIDEO (VCR or DVD)
Many VCRs provide S-Video signals for improved picture quality.
1. Connect the S-VIDEO output of a VCR to the S-VIDEO input on the TV.
2. Connect the audio cables from the S-VIDEO VCR to the L(MONO) R inputs of the TV.
3. Select S-VIDEO mode by pressing the TV/AV button repeatedly. The TV’s TV/AV button
may be disabled to prevent patient or visitor tampering – see the “Special” menu and
“Lock” instructions elsewhere in this manual for details.
4. Press the PLAY button on the VCR.
A/V IN (VCR)
1. Connect the audio outputs from the VCR (L, R) to the A/V in on the TV.
Connections are color code.
2. Connect the video output from the VCR to the A/V in on the TV.
Connection is color-coded.
3. Select VIDEO mode by pressing the TV/AV button repeatedly. The TV/AV button can be
disabled using the remote control to prevent patient or visitor tampering – see the
“Special” menu and “Lock” instructions elsewhere in this manual for details.
4. Press the PLAY button on the VCR.
